Taylor Swift Spotted Watching Lions/Chiefs ‘SNF’ Game with Basketball Superstar

  • On Oct. 12, Taylor Swift attended the Kansas City Chiefs' home game at Arrowhead Stadium, marking her first confirmed appearance of the 2025 season as they faced the Detroit Lions.
  • Following her Oct. 3 album drop and August engagement, Taylor Swift has been promoting The Life of a Showgirl while celebrating her romance with Chiefs tight end Travis Kelce.
  • Sharing a box with Caitlin Clark, Indiana Fever guard, Swift hugged Ed Kelce, Travis Kelce's father, during the Sunday Night Football broadcast with an 8:20 p.m. ET kickoff.
  • Given Kansas City's 19-4 all-time record when Swift is in attendance, her presence has historically coincided with strong team performances as the Chiefs face a potential drop to 2-4.
  • The visit underscores how pop culture and the NFL intersect, as Taylor Swift's attendance highlights this crossover and commissioner Roger Goodell has invited her to the Super Bowl halftime show.
